Transaction 66a3d2caeb43325d864cda3fb88090bd8bcf57cb2225965f8af805ec5b3b8eb1
1 Input
1 Output
-
66a3d2caeb43325d864cda3fb88090bd8bcf57cb2225965f8af805ec5b3b8eb1:0
- value
- 1340053665
- script pubkey
- OP_0 OP_PUSHBYTES_32 1381224c3d886f7fecc542cbcf4d0d0751cca2d5d6d587ec4ef4f23b5783a2a7
- address
- bc1qzwqjynpa3phhlmx9gt9u7ngdqaguegk46m2c0mzw7nerk4ur52ns0q2jwt